About the Instrument
This viola has a gorgeous sound that maintains its strength and delicacy across registers, making it an ideal solo instrument while also versatile enough to integrate into group ensembles. Made for comfort, this petite, acoustically designed viola bears small Kreisler Guarneri f-holes to lower air resonances. Its two-piece European maple back has a medium flame slanting downward from the center joint. Its auburn varnish brings out the figures along its back, sides, and scroll.

Measurements:
String length: 362 mm
Body length: 400 mm
Stop: 214 mm
Upper bout: 188 mm
Center: 128 mm
Lower bout: 241 mm

About the Maker
David Ludwik Chrapkiewicz
(“Rap-kye-vich”) is a contemporary Canadian luthier based in Bar Harbor, Maine. Chrapkiewicz studied violin making with former Mittenwald Shop Master, Alois Vogl, and Raymond Forget in Montreal, Canada. Later, he worked with William Moennig II in Nashville to further cultivate his capacities in antiquing. Since 1979, Chrapkiewicz has been a full-time violin maker since setting up his ateliers in Iowa City (1979-1984), Nashville (1984-1992), near New York City (1992-1998), near Washington, D.C. (1998-2020). He has been posted in Bar Harbor, Maine since 2020. Chrapkiewicz has earned multiple tone awards, including a Silver Medal for Tone in the Violin Society of America’s International Competition. He has exhibited his work at the VSA International Competition as well presented at the VSA’s Oberlin Summer Workshops. His professional memberships include: American Viola Society, Violin Society of America, Balalaika and Domra Association of America, Catgut Acoustical Society, Guild of American Luthiers, String Industry Council, among others.
